Why this recipe works
Salade Niçoise should remain fresh and clear. Beans are only blanched to bite, eggs are boiled waxy or hard and the dressing is used sparingly. The ingredients are prepared, not stirred into a heavy salad.
Recipe
Salade Niçoise is a southern French salad with tomatoes, green beans, egg, tuna, olives, anchovies and a clear dijon vinaigrette.
Blanch green beans and chill out. Cook eggs waxy or hard.
Mix olive oil, red wine vinegar, Dijon-mustard, salt and pepper into a clear vinaigrette.
Cut tomatoes, cucumber and red onion. Pick herbs.
Place beans, tomatoes, cucumber, onion, tuna, eggs, olives and anchovies on a plate.
Add Vinaigrette sparingly and serve with basil. Do not mix heavily.
